Slow down! Cat hit by van in SO19

Sad news to report that a cat has been hit by a large white van this evening. 

A witness contacted us a short time ago to confirm that the incident happened on Bridge Road, Woolston. We don’t have any information about the van or driver, but from the witness, it would appear that the driver would have realised something had been hit; alas, he/she didn’t have the courtesy or decency to stop.  

The witness (and neighbouring homeowners) were able to locate the owner of the cat and it has been taken to the vets to be assessed. At this stage, all we can say is that its back legs are not in a good way; we can only hope that the Vet is able to help.

Please, some of the roads we travel down frequently are narrow with cars parked on both sides narrowing them further. A few miles an hour slower is all it could take to prevent these unfortunate incidents occurring.

Thoughts now are with the cat owner.
